Tesla has leased a 24,565 sq. ft. warehousing facility in Kurla West, Mumbai.
The monthly rent for the warehouse is Rs 37.53 lakh, which translates to Rs 153 per sq. ft.
The lease term for the warehouse is five years, with a 5% annual rent escalation.
Additional common area maintenance (CAM) charges are Rs 10 per sq. ft., also subject to a 5% annual escalation.
This lease is a significant step in Tesla's multi-city rollout strategy, serving as a key logistics hub for wider distribution and service operations in western India.
